Ultimates 3 Covers Revealed

Ultimates3HEROESpicon.jpg

One of my students asked me when the next Ultimates series was going to be released, and now I can tell him – December 05, 2007. I’m included in the number of fans that liked the series, and the third looks like it is going to be a smash.

Such a smash that Marvel is releasing two gatefold covers that connect into one giant panoramic shot.

“When we first talked about how to launch Ultimates 3, we wanted something that both the retailers and the fans could sink their teeth into,” explained award-winning writer Loeb. “I’d been a huge fan of Joe Mad’s Uncanny X-Men #350 with that triple-gatefold and it’s hardly ever done anymore. But since we’re in the Ultimates it had to be even bigger than that! Working with Chris Lightner’s magic digital inks and colors, Joe created TWO covers — HEROES and VILLAINS all rushing toward each other. And when you put them together it makes one massive poster. So much so, that Marvel is releasing them as posters! We also wanted to thank you all for being patient while we put this together properly. Joe and Chris are at the height of their game and having been away from comics for a few years, these Hall of Famers have returned with a vengeance. Go Ultimates!”

The Circle Brings the Espionage

fullcirclepicon.jpg

Image Comics has announced writer Brian Reed and artist Ian Hosfeld will be launching their first creator-owned book, The Circle, this November.

“It’s in the vein of the classic TV show Mission: Impossible, or The Man From U.N.C.L.E., and somewhat inspired by the fantastic long running comic strip Modesty Blaise,” said Reed in a prepared statement. “The Circle is a group of freedom fighters that first formed amidst the horrible civil wars in the Baltics during the late 1990′s, and today operate as guns for hire.”

Change the Past and Save the Future in New Image Book

This November, Image Comics will release a new four-issue miniseries written by Nightly News writer Jonathan Hickman.

While THE NIGHTLY NEWS was a gripping, media-centric thriller with an edgy political slant, Hickman is best known for utilizing an art style consisting of double page spreads which married traditional comic art with elements of graphic design. With PAX ROMANA, Jonathan will again be pushing the boundaries of storytelling while telling the tale of 5,000 men sent on an impossible mission to change the past and save the future.
